Crate and Barrel Sr UI Designer Salaries in Boulder

The average Crate and Barrel Sr UI Designer in Boulder earns an estimated $114,514 annually. Crate and Barrel's Sr UI Designer compensation is $4,731 less than the US average for a Sr UI Designer.

In Boulder, The Design Department at Crate and Barrel earns $8,869 more on average than the Marketing Department.

Sr UI Designer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female Sr UI Designer at companies similar size to Crate and Barrel reported making $134,465, while the average male Sr UI Designer at similar sized companies reported making $138,327.

Sr UI Designer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Asian or Pacific Islander Sr UI Designer at companies similar size to Crate and Barrel reported making $146,434, while the average Native American Sr UI Designer at similar sized companies reported making $106,500.
